WebSelect File > Logging or select Alt+L. The Terminal displays a dialog box to prompt you for the location and name of the log file. The default directory is install-dir/mgr. The default … WebIf you know you want to decouple beforehand you would use: nohup gedit &. Maybe you will want to redirect the shell output as well and your program a pseudo input source, so: nohup ./myprogram > foo.out 2> bar.err < /dev/null &. You would want to redirect the output to either not be annoyed by it or to use it later. ontario ministry of children \u0026 youth services https://soulandkind.com

WebFeb 24, 2024 · Most terminal commands have options — these are modifiers that you add onto the end of a command, which make it behave in a slightly different way. These usually consist of a space after the command name, followed by a dash, followed by one or more letters. For example, give this a go and see what you get: ls -l

WebExecute the iris terminal command inside the container using docker exec; the -i (interactive) option keeps standard input open in a detached container, and -t allocates a pseudo-terminal. (To exit the InterSystems Terminal, enter halt .) $ docker exec -it my-iris iris session IRIS Node: 8a6940088a16, Instance: IRIS USER&gt; WebDocumentation – Arm Developer FVP command-line options Specify these options when you launch an FVP from the command line.
